Medco to shut site, offer staff work-at-home plan (NorthJersey.com)

Medco Health Solutions Inc. confirmed Thursday it plans to vacate a Montvale facility where about 560 employees work. The information technology workers will get the option to work from home or transfer to other Medco operations in Fair Lawn or Franklin Lakes.

16 August 2005 Mobile users are less mobile, survey finds (Planet Analog)

Mobility has a new, more static, meaning according to a study released Tuesday by market research firm Strategy Analytics. The study found that, in Western Europe, almost two-thirds of all wireless voice and data minutes are used either at work or at home.

Business (Woodstock Independent)

Jack Bavaro wants to help families take their photographs out of shoeboxes and preserve them. Bavaro, owner of Forever in Memories, a Wonder Lake home-based business, works with families to blend photographs, slides, old home movies and videotapes into a digital music video of their family history.
